One of the things that I hope we clear up as the season progresses is that it seems like Towns, DLo and Ant seem to decide for themselves when it’s “their turn,” regardless of the situation. You can feel when Towns is going to drive, or DLo is calling his own number. Ant seems to disappear when he doesn’t think it’s Ant-time. Some of this I’ve seen from them before, and it’s probably part of their personality, but as they play more together and pass more, hopefully each will learn to take easier shots when they appear, not when they decide it’s their turn.
